AGS NEWS – Endwell Ahuize Ejindu, a young man, was shot dead in Ahoada East Local Government Area of Rivers State.

Ejindu was ambushed and shot at close range by unknown assailants along the Ula-Upata Road in Ahoada main town around 9pm on Tuesday, June 18, 2024.

Ejindu was the Student Union Government (SUG) President of Elechi Amadi Polytechnic, Port Harcourt, during the 2017/2018 academic session.

Reports indicate he participated in a protest at the council headquarters on Tuesday, with a viral video showing him chanting and waving an Ijaw Youth Council flag alongside other youths.

Sources say Ejindu left the protest, where they were demonstrating against the extension of the LG chairmen’s tenure, and boarded a motorcycle.

As the motorcycle headed towards Ula-Pata Road, three gunmen opened fire on him.

Ejindu died instantly, while the motorcyclist, who was injured, was taken to a hospital for treatment.

It was also revealed that Ejindu and his wife had recently welcomed a baby.

The Rivers State Police Command has not yet commented on the incident.
